7.1 August 23, 1967 Letter from Frank

 August 23 Dear Folks,     We finally arrived at Kigari. This is a beautiful spot! Our house faces the southeast and we overlook the plain down toward the ocean just as far as we can see. Visibility today was about 25 to 30 miles and then things vanished into haze. We of course could not see the ocean, but it goes down hill from here to the ocean. Our house is a three bedroom stone structure with a tile roof and plastered on the inside with nice sized windows looking out over the plain. We are about 30 miles from the top of Mt. Kenya, and we haven't been able to see it yet because of clouds. We are about  5700 feet altitude here and are about 70 miles south of the equator, but the temperatures are very mild. Nights are down right cool and days are comfortable in shirt sleeves, and of course this is their cool season.     So far we have about every kind of fruit growing here at the school.
